😐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,646 in Mexico City versus $1,487 in Vila do Conde.
😐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,613 in Mexico City versus $2,324 in Vila do Conde.
😐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$3,580 in Mexico City versus $3,161 in Vila do Conde.
🌍Living in Mexico City is roughly 11% more expensive than in Vila do Conde,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Both cities are pricier than the global median: Mexico City20% above, Vila do Conde8% above.
